The rakeback percentage offered by a poker room is another factor to consider when choosing a site. It is important to find a site that offers at least 25% rakeback, but it’s better if they offer more than this. It’s also important to check if they offer alternative ways to reward players, such as loyalty points that can be exchanged for cash or bonuses.

Some poker rooms even have their own loyalty programs that pay out points based on how much money you play and how often. This can be a great way to build your bankroll and can help you reach the top of the leaderboards.

The best online poker sites also offer a wide variety of software that can help you improve your game. These include hand database applications that save and sort all of the hands you’ve played on the computer. Some of these applications also come with a heads up display (HUD) that allows you to view information about your opponents and their previous hand histories.
